President's Message
 
Melanie Perkins headshot

Dear Members and Friends,

 

Congratulations to 2012 AFP DFW Philanthropy Conference chair Jennifer Hawthorne, co-chair Judy Wright and the entire planning committee on a hugely successful event! A wide variety of topical presentations, everything from Social Media to Major Gifts to Effective Boards to Civility in the Workplace, was covered to benefit hundreds of attendees. I always learn a new skill or a much better way to do what I've been doing when I attend the DFW Philanthropy Conference, and I'm already looking forward to next year's event.

 

Nominations to the 2013 Board of Directors for the Greater Dallas Chapter of AFP are open and being accepted through July 31, 2012. A strong board ensures the continuity of outstanding servant leadership that has been a hallmark of our chapter. Please feel free to nominate yourself or a fellow member of our Chapter whom you feel is available and ready to serve. Both the Nomination Form and the Nominating Committee Guidelines are available at http://www.afpdallas.org/board.asp.
